Napoli have confirmed muscle accidents to Matteo Politano and Amir Rrahmani and in accordance with Italian sources, the Partenopei duo will stay out of motion for a minimum of two weeks.

Napoli offered damage updates on Politano and Rrahmani on Monday morning.

Italian sources, together with SOS Fanta and Sky Sport, declare that each gamers will certainly miss the subsequent two video games in opposition to Copenhagen within the Champions League and Juventus in Serie A.

It would take as much as two weeks to see Rrahmani and Politano return to motion, even when the Italian may even want a month to recuperate.

These newest accidents add to a protracted record of Napoli’s absentees because the Partenopei have been compelled to manage with out Billy Gilmour, Romelu Lukaku, Kevin De Bruyne, Frank Zambo Anguissa and Alex Meret for a number of months.

Lukaku hasn’t but made a single look this season, whereas De Bruyne has been out of motion since October and gained’t be obtainable once more till March.
